Output d69247481ea24bfc960b90c33102fc17ead799863d338adc1d7c9f69c96ab817:1

value
18512000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eaf3b255c43c3b89a50d3f6501039b9c89bf81f OP_EQUAL
address
3PT4fTwvHfE95Nt59p75rX13dofVZsjurx
transaction
d69247481ea24bfc960b90c33102fc17ead799863d338adc1d7c9f69c96ab817
spent
true